Position: Senior Consultant, Healthcare Advisory
Department: Compliance Advisory, Healthcare

Requirements

TARGET SKILLSETS

  • Experience 4 + years in security audit, assessment, compliance, risk management, or data privacy role
  • Healthcare time in field 3+ years as relates to cybersecurity
  • Consulting experience in healthcare vertical
  • Knowledge of cloud provider services (AWS, Azure, GCP)
  • Knowledge of NIST; special publications that deal with how to build a GRC program in general
  • Frameworks: NIST-800 53, 30, 37, 39, 61, 161
  • HIPAA (HITRUST bonus but HIPAA more important)
  • Coach, mentor, teach at senior level
  • Project management skills with an eye on budget constraints (timelines and backward planning)
  • Strong client problem solving skills as it relates to scheduling conflicts and other items

MUST HAVE

  • Time in field 4+ years as relates to cybersecurity (can be mix of internal and external client facing)
  • Problem solving, time management, ability to multitask
  • Not afraid of taking a part and flying with it; take initiative and take skills to the next level
  • Need to have seen the technical implementation side of NIST, CMS, or HIPAA/HITRUST at least two of those frameworks at a minimum, capable leader and manager of projects for deliverables
  • Ability to delegate tasks, leading junior consultants – technical areas relevant to frameworks
  • Fully leading client/stakeholder conversations with consulting firm experience
  • Strong communication skills in working with C-Suite

NICE TO HAVE

  • Crossover with risk analysis (knowledge of SOC2, ISO)
  • CMS audit experience
  • CISSP
  • CCP, CHPS, HCISPP, CCSK, CCSFP, CIPP/US
  • Bachelor’s or MBA, cyber related degree, computer science training
  • AI RMF and/or ISO 42001
  • Big 4 experience
  • Cloud Certifications

 

 

Job responsibilities

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ES

  • At least 3 engagements at a time
  • Leading engagements
  • Manage a 2 nd -seat person/monitoring quality
  • Sit in on scoping calls for sales (provide input)
  • Product development blogs/white papers that support practice objectives
  • Learning how to be a Principal
  • Every project can be different; use problem solving skills; keeping up with current trends
  • Evaluate for risk and compliance standards, see if any gaps
  • Technical: Packages, tailored solutions, white papers, roadmap
  • Work with engineering, Q&A, assist sales
  • Performing QA, creating thought leadership, create content and publish public facing used for marketing purposes, build their band and credibility – through blogs, webinars, huge opp
  • Practice improvement initiatives, field guide rolling out new tool – also integrating AI, and overall delivery process
  • Standardized risk analysis, customized cyber security engagements, risk management and compliance engagements that solve unique client
    problems and pain points; staff augmentation, resiliency planning and products
  • Help clients develop risk plans, programs for third party risk, help get audit ready, gap analysis/readiness
